Superconductivity in bulk T′-(La,Sm)2CuO4 prepared via a molten alkaline hydroxide route
چکیده انگلیسی

We have synthesized La2−xSmxCuO4 (0 ⩽ x ⩽ 2.0) with the Nd2CuO4 structure via a molten alkaline hydroxide route at temperatures as low as 400–480 °C. After reduction heat treatment in vacuum at 600–750 °C for removal of excess oxygen atoms at the interstitial apical site, superconductivity with Tc = 20–24 K was observed in the samples with x = 0.05–1.0. The superconducting volume fraction is nearly 100% for x = 0.3–0.7. Our results demonstrate that La2−xSmxCuO4 with no nominal carrier doping is a bulk superconductor.


► Low-temperature synthesis of superconducting La2–xSmxCuO4 with the Nd2CuO4 structure via a molten alkaline hydroxide route.
► Superconductivity with Tc = 20–24 K was observed for x = 0.05–1.0 after reduction heat treatments for the removal of interstitial apical oxygen atoms.
► The results present clear evidence of bulk superconductivity in the nominally undoped La2–xSmxCuO4 system.
